CM gifts development projects worth Rs 875 Crore for Dumka and Jamtara

Thursday, 19 September 2024 | PNS | Ranchi

In the programme "Aapki Yojana- Aapki Sarkar- Aapke Dwar", Chief Minister Hemant Soren today gifted schemes worth Rs 875 crore to Dumka and Jamtara districts. Where various development schemes were inaugurated and assets worth about 30697.5 lakh rupees were distributed among 4,77,715 beneficiaries of both the districts. The Chief Minister directly communicated with the beneficiaries of various panchayats of both the districts through video conferencing. He inaugurated schemes worth 710 crore 57 lakh 23 thousand rupees and distributed assets among 263734 beneficiaries of Jamtara district.

The CM inaugurated schemes worth 164 crore 99 lakh rupees and distributed assets among a total of 213981 beneficiaries of Dumka district. In this, 275 schemes worth Rs 40428.98 lakh were inaugurated and foundation stone was laid under Jamtara district and 23 schemes worth Rs 95.74 lakh were inaugurated and foundation stone was laid under Dumka district. Forest patta of 66 acres of land was distributed among the beneficiaries on the occasion.

On this occasion, energisation of 132/33 KV (2x50 MVA) grid sub-station Kundhit and related double path LILO transmission line was done. This grid sub-station has been constructed with the joint efforts of Chief Minister Shri Hemant Soren and Assembly Speaker Shri Rabindranath Mahato. Whose energizing capacity is 2 x 50 MVA (100 MVA) through which electricity is to be supplied to many electric power sub-stations respectively 33 KV Nala, Kundhit, Bamandiha, Fatehpur etc., so that electricity supply can be ensured to the residents of the benefiting blocks Nala, Kundhit, Bamandiha and Fatehpur area, these grid sub-stations are capable of bearing the electricity load for the next 15 to 20 years.

The construction of this project has cost approximately Rs 82.37 crore. Electricity supply to this newly constructed grid will be provided from 132/33 KV grid sub-stations located at Jamtara and Madhupur. After energizing this grid, about 80 MW additional electricity will be supplied, which will directly/indirectly benefit lakhs of people of various areas of Jamtara district like Nala, Kundhit, Bamandiha and Fatehpur etc. and will get rid of the problem of low voltage. This grid sub-station has been constructed with the aim of supplying quality electricity to the respected residents in view of the 30-year vision of the government.
